Shake roof replacement services involve removing an existing shake or shingle roof and installing a new, durable roofing system. This process typically includes inspecting the roof’s structure, tearing off the old materials, and carefully installing new shakes or shingles that suit the property’s style and needs.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ity, improve its appearance, and ensure it provides reliable protection against weather elements. These services are performed by experienced contractors who understand the specific requirements of shake roofing, ensuring a professional and long-lasting result.

This type of roof replacement helps address a variety of common problems that can develop over time. For example, aging shingles or shakes may become brittle, cracked, or warped, leading to leaks and water damage inside the property. Damage from storms, hail, or falling debris can also compromise the roof’s surface, creating vulnerabilities. Additionally, issues like moss or algae growth, uneven wear, or missing shingles can diminish the roof’s effectiveness and curb appeal. Shake roof replacement provides a way to resolve these issues, restoring the roof’s functionality and appearance.

Homeowners should consider shake roof replacement when signs of deterioration become evident or when repairs are no longer effective. Common indicators include curled, cracked, or missing shingles, visible water stains on ceilings, or increased energy costs due to poor insulation. If the roof has sustained storm damage or shows extensive wear, replacement may be the most practical solution. The overview below groups typical Shake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or roof repairs or patch jobs generally range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, though prices can vary based on roof size and material. Larger repairs or multiple issues may push costs higher.

Partial Roof Replacement - replacing a section of the roof often costs between $1,000 and $3,500. Local contractors usually handle these projects within this range, with larger or more complex sections potentially exceeding $4,000.

Full Roof Replacement - complete roof replacements typically fall between $5,000 and $15,000. Most projects are priced in the middle of this range, but larger or high-end materials can increase costs beyond $20,000.

Complex or High-End Projects - extensive or premium roof replacements can reach $20,000 or more, especially for large, intricate roofs with specialty materials. Such projects are less common but represent the upper end of typical costs for local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of a shake roof replacement? A shake roof replacement can enhance the appearance of a home and improve its durability against weather elements. Local contractors can assess if a replacement is suitable based on the current condition of the roof.

How do I know if my shake roof needs to be replaced? Signs such as extensive cracking, curling, missing shingles, or water leaks may indicate the need for a replacement. Service providers can evaluate the roof's condition to determine if replacement is recommended.

What types of shake roofing materials are available for replacement? There are various options including cedar, composite, and synthetic shakes. Local roofing professionals can help select the best material based on the home's needs and aesthetic preferences.

Can a shake ro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damages can often be repaired, but extensive wear or damage may require a full replacement. Service providers can advise on the most effective solution for the specific situation.
